secession

英 [sɪˈseʃn]

美 [sɪˈseʃn]

n.  (地区或集团从所属的国家或上级集团的)退出,脱离

复数:secessions 

TEM8

Collins.1 / BNC.17439 / COCA.14688

牛津词典

    noun

    • (地区或集团从所属的国家或上级集团的)退出,脱离
      the fact of an area or group becoming independent from the country or larger group that it belongs to

      柯林斯词典

      • N-UNCOUNT (从国家、大集团的)退出,脱离,分离
        Thesecessionof a region or group from the country or larger group to which it belongs is the action of formally becoming separate.
        1. ...the Ukraine's secession from the Soviet Union.
          乌克兰之退出苏联

      英英释义

      noun

      • formal separation from an alliance or federation
          Synonym:withdrawal
        1. an Austrian school of art and architecture parallel to the French art nouveau in the 1890s
            Synonym:sezession
